is a groundbreaking, open-source Linux operating system designed to replace the restrictive, proprietary firmware found on IP cameras. By liberating embedded hardware from vendor lock-in, OpenIPC transforms cheap, mass-produced hardware into highly secure, powerful, and customizable edge-computing devices. What is OpenIPC?
OpenIPC includes a full ONVIF 2.4 implementation. This means any standard NVR (Synology, QNAP, Blue Iris, Frigate) can discover and manage your camera automatically—no proprietary plugins required. OpenIPC contains
Modern IP camera chips contain powerful Neural Processing Units (NPUs) that usually sit idle. OpenIPC unlocks these hardware accelerators. By running lightweight machine learning models directly on the camera chip, OpenIPC can perform on-device motion, human, vehicle, and facial detection, drastically reducing the CPU strain on your central NVR. Stock camera firmware regularly connects to external servers, often overseas, to facilitate remote viewing through proprietary apps. OpenIPC strips away these hidden telemetry features. Your data remains strictly within your local network unless you choose to route it elsewhere. 2. Elimination of Subscriptions
